Connecting the dishwasher to the electrical supply. £55. Connecting the dishwasher to the water supply and drain line. £60–£100 per hour. Locate the water valve on the dishwasher. Wrap the threads with exactly two turns of plumber's thread seal tape (Image 1). Attach the existing water line to the valve. Hand-tighten as much as possible (Image 2) and then, using a set of channel-lock pliers, tighten just a nudge more (approximately 1/16 of a turn). Adjust the appliance's height if needed, using the leveling legs found on the bottom of the dishwasher. Check that the dishwasher is level, both side-to-side and front-to-back. Use shims if needed. Secure the dishwasher to the underside of the countertop using brackets and screws. This provides fresh water to clean your dishes.The standard dishwasher size is typically 24 inches wide, 24 inches deep and 35 inches tall. Cabinet openings in many home kitchens today are built to fit this standard dishwasher size. Tall tub dishwashers typically have the same external dimensions as standard dishwashers. Today I'm replacing my dishwasher and I wanted to bring you along to show you how to remove your old dishwasher and inst...Nov 3, 2021 · The cost range for traditional built-in dishwashers starts at $300 for cheaper models and goes up to around $1,000 for high-end, stainless steel dishwashers. Single drawer dishwasher prices fall between $300 and $800, while double drawer units can be as expensive as $1,500. Portable dishwashers typically fall around the $500 mark. Step 1: Prepare the Area Where It’ll Be Installed. The opening space has to be 24” wide x 24” deep x 34 ½” high – this is the standard size for dishwasher’s space. You have to make sure that the back wall doesn’t have any pipes or wires on it.How much does it cost to install a commercial dishwasher. On average, a commercial dishwasher installation costs $350, and it usually falls between $175-$525.
